Multicode system is designed to get more spreading sequences and get higher multiplexing capacity in large-area-synchronized code division multiple access (LAS-CDMA) system. The computational complexity is too high for the optimum detection algorithm using maximum-likelihood (ML) rule and the genetic algorithm (GA) method is often applied to get the suboptimum solution since it is able to greatly decrease the detection complexity. Another sphere decoding (SD) algorithm can also independently reach a near-optimum solution due to a constrained searching operation. A modified detection algorithm based on genetic algorithm method is proposed, where sphere decoding is an additional embedded operation for each GA iteration. The simulation results shows that a SDassisted GA detector can obtain the same performance as that of the classic GA detector with fewer iterations.
